Golden Temptation – A Yuri Story - Chapter 87
“Fei’er, are you really planning to go abroad?” Liu Xinyu asked, clearly reluctant to let her go.
“Mm. I’ve already submitted the application to the school.”
“Fei’er, I know you’re hurting inside, but seeing you like this makes me feel even worse! Is it really over between you and Jing Xuan? Don’t you love her deeply? Why are you giving up?”
“Xinyu, my love for Xuan will never change. But I can’t be selfish. Loving someone doesn’t always mean you get to be together. As long as she’s happy, then I’ll be happy too.”
“Wow… Fei’er, that’s such a noble kind of love. But I still can’t agree with you. You have to fight for your own happiness! If two people love each other, they should be together. Just the thought of two people in love being apart sounds painful—how can you call that happiness?
If someone is separated from the one they love and still tells themselves, ‘As long as I’m happy, they’ll be happy too,’ then unless they’re an idiot, they must be brain-dead!”
With that, Liu Xinyu took a furious sip of her milkshake.
Qiao Fei laughed at her adorable reaction. “I never thought Xinyu would grow up so much—you’re no longer that little doll I used to know.”
“You sound just like my mom! With all the nonsense I’ve been through, it’s impossible not to grow up.”
Hearing that, a wave of melancholy washed over Qiao Fei. She missed Jing Xuan. She had thought that even if she still missed her after they parted ways, time would eventually dull the feeling. But instead, the longing had grown wild like weeds—completely out of control. Still, at least it meant she still had a soul. If even this yearning disappeared, she’d really become an empty shell.
“How are things with Shuangji?”
“Oh, her? Same as always! I don’t know how that rascal manages to charm everyone—she even has my mom wrapped around her finger!”
“What? Seriously?”
“I swear! Every day she sweet-talks my parents until they act like she’s their real daughter. They absolutely adore her!”
“Haha. Isn’t there a saying, ‘A son-in-law is half a son’? In this case, maybe Shuangji’s just trying to protect you. Isn’t that a good thing?”
“Oh my god, Fei’er! You too? Even you are siding with that scoundrel! My tragic fate!”
They both burst into laughter.
While Qiao Fei and Liu Xinyu chatted happily at the mall’s smoothie shop, just two floors above them, Jing Xuan was carefully picking out a ring in a jewelry store.
Jing Xuan was going to propose to Lan Qing.
Ever since handing Huatian Group over to Gao Zhe, the guy had proven to be an impressive manager. So Jing Xuan shifted her focus to running the company and reorganizing her gang. After restructuring, the
Jingdong Society retained its traditional rules, but under Jing Xuan’s leadership, it began thriving again and quickly regained prominence in the underworld.
It was time to give the girl she loved a home—and herself some peace.
She still remembered the joy in Lan Qing’s eyes when she saw the ring Jing Xuan had originally picked out for Qiao Fei. From that moment, she knew she could never marry anyone else. Lan Qing had seen through it, of course—she was too perceptive not to—but still insisted on “keeping the ring for Fei’er,” probably to put Jing Xuan’s heart at ease.
Now, as she held the perfect ring in her hand, Jing Xuan couldn’t help but smile.

Lan Qing had been very busy lately, saying she was building her own business, acting all mysterious about it. She was the youngest in their little group of four, the baby sister, really—so the others let her do her thing. But she had no idea what surprise Jing Xuan was planning for her next.
February 14 — Valentine’s Day
As night fell, the interior of Huatian had been transformed. The theme was romantic elegance—purple and silver hues lit with soft golden highlights created a dreamy, luxurious atmosphere.
A grand celebration was about to begin.
That night, Lan Qing wore a sky-blue fitted evening gown. The shoulders were styled in a graceful Greek design. Her long hair was swept up in an elegant bun, with golden highlights at the tips. Her delicate makeup and vibrant red lips made her look like a goddess descended to earth.
“Wow! Sister Lan Qing, you look absolutely stunning!” Liu Xinyu’s eyes lit up with admiration. She had known Lan Qing for years, but still, every time she saw her like this, she was amazed.
In her heart, she had often compared Qiao Fei and Lan Qing: Fei’er’s beauty was ethereal and pure, like a fairy untouched by the world; Lan Qing, on the other hand, was seductive and regal, a proud queen. How many men must secretly curse Jing Xuan’s name? Two extraordinary women, both devoted to her alone.
All evening, Lan Qing couldn’t find any trace of Jing Xuan. When she asked others, they only smiled and said nothing.
Just as DJ Yin Yi pushed the party into full swing, the music blasting and the crowd buzzing, Lan Qing’s delicate figure seemed to vanish in the chaos. Suddenly, the beat softened, replaced by the bright strumming of a guitar and a warm, magnetic voice:
🎵 “It’s a beautiful night, we’re looking for something dumb to do…
Hey baby, I think I wanna marry you…” 🎵
As the romantic song continued, lights dimmed and focused on the source of the music.
There she was.
Jing Xuan stood under the spotlight, singing with a guitar in hand. She wore only a simple white shirt, black casual pants rolled up at the cuffs, and a pair of brown loafers. Her short, tousled hair and relaxed appearance gave off a clean, sunny charm.
As the final chords rang out and the song ended, she put the guitar down and walked toward Lan Qing. The crowd instinctively parted, forming a path between them.
Jing Xuan wore a radiant smile as she stepped forward, each footfall making Lan Qing’s heart tremble. She approached slowly, knelt down on one knee, and opened a velvet ring box.
With a warm, gentle voice, she said:
“Beautiful lady, will you marry me?”
